Инструменты пользователя

Инструменты сайта


flip:glaber:installing_glaber_3.5_on_alt_linux_10.4

Различия

Показаны различия между двумя версиями страницы.

Ссылка на это сравнение

Предыдущая версия справа и слеваПредыдущая версия
Следующая версия
Предыдущая версия
flip:glaber:installing_glaber_3.5_on_alt_linux_10.4 [2025/09/03 13:07] flipflip:glaber:installing_glaber_3.5_on_alt_linux_10.4 [2025/09/04 10:00] (текущий) flip
Строка 1: Строка 1:
 ====== Установка Glaber 3.5 на AltLinux 10.4 ====== ====== Установка Glaber 3.5 на AltLinux 10.4 ======
- 
-Статья редактируется! ;-) 
  
 === Стек: === === Стек: ===
Строка 21: Строка 19:
 apt-get update apt-get update
 apt-get dist-upgrade apt-get dist-upgrade
-apt-get install nano wget nginx mariadb clickhouse-server php8.2 php8.2-fpm-fcgi php8.2-gd php8.2-mbstring php8.2-mysqli php8.2-openssl php8.2-pgsql php8.2-sockets php8.2-xmlreader php8.2-curl php8.2-ldap php8.2-mysqlnd fping libopenipmi libnet-snmp35 libssh libunixODBC-devel-compat+apt-get install nano wget nginx mariadb clickhouse-server clickhouse-client php8.2 php8.2-fpm-fcgi php8.2-gd php8.2-mbstring php8.2-mysqli php8.2-openssl php8.2-pgsql php8.2-sockets php8.2-xmlreader php8.2-curl php8.2-ldap php8.2-mysqlnd fping libopenipmi libnet-snmp35 libssh libunixODBC-devel-compat
 </code> </code>
  
Строка 150: Строка 148:
 nano /etc/fpm8.2/php-fpm.d/glaber.conf nano /etc/fpm8.2/php-fpm.d/glaber.conf
 </code> </code>
 +
 +Добавить:
 +> listen.owner = _nginx
 +> listen.group = _nginx
 +> listen.mode = 0660
  
 Заменить: Заменить:
Строка 226: Строка 229:
 > $DB['PASSWORD'                = 'glaber_password'; > $DB['PASSWORD'                = 'glaber_password';
  
 +
 +=== Создать символическую ссылку ===
 +
 +<code>
 +ln -s /etc/glaber/web/maintenance.inc.php /usr/share/glaber/conf/
 +</code>
  
 === Автозагрузка и запуск === === Автозагрузка и запуск ===
Строка 233: Строка 242:
 </code> </code>
  
 +=== Веб-интерфейс ===
 +
 +  * ''<nowiki>http://<IP_SERVER>/</nowiki>''
 +
 +
 +===== Настройка ClickHouse =====
 +
 +По умолчанию на БД пароль не установлен!
 +
 +=== Автозагрузка и запуск ===
 +
 +<code>
 +systemctl enable clickhouse-server --now
 +</code>
 +
 +Файл со схемой БД лежит тут: \\
 +https://gitlab.com/mikler/glaber/-/blob/3.5/database/clickhouse/schema.sql
 +
 +=== Скачиваем схему БД и импортируем ===
 +
 +<code>
 +wget https://gitlab.com/mikler/glaber/-/raw/3.5/database/clickhouse/schema.sql
 +clickhouse-client --multiquery < schema.sql
 +</code>
 +
 +=== Добавляем БД в Glaber ===
 +
 +<code>
 +nano /etc/glaber/glaber_server.conf
 +</code>
 +
 +Находим строку ''HistoryModule='' и правим под свои значения
 +
 +Пример без пароля: \\
 +''<nowiki>HistoryModule=clickhouse;{"url":"http://127.0.0.1:8123", "username":"default", "dbname":"glaber",  "disable_reads":100, "timeout":10 }</nowiki>''
 +
 +=== Перезапускаем Glaber ===
 +
 +<code>
 +systemctl restart glaber-server
 +</code>
 +
 +
 +===== Настройка Glaber-агента =====
 +
 +Файл с настройками: \\
 +''/etc/glaber/glaber_agentd.conf''
 +
 +=== Автозагрузка и запуск ===
 +
 +<code>
 +systemctl enable glaber-agent --now
 +</code>
 +
 +
 +===== Устранение проблем =====
 +
 +  * Логи находятся в каталоге: ''/var/log/glaber/''
 +  * После правки файла конфигурации необходимо перезапускать Glaber
 +
 +==== Проблема с /var/vcdump/ ====
 +
 +> <nowiki>Loading state file '/var/vcdump//items.gz'</nowiki>
 +> <nowiki>Cannot open file /var/vcdump//items.gz for access check, exiting</nowiki>
 +> <nowiki>Loading state file '/var/vcdump//triggers.gz'</nowiki>
 +> <nowiki>Cannot open file /var/vcdump//triggers.gz for access check, exiting</nowiki>
 +
 +=== Фикс ===
 +
 +В файле настроек: ''/etc/glaber/glaber_server.conf'' \\
 +В параметре убрать в конце слеш: ''ValueCacheDumpLocation=/var/vcdump'' \\
 +<code>
 +mkdir /var/vcdump
 +chown glaber:glaber /var/vcdump
 +</code>
 +
 +
 +==== Проблема MIBs ====
 +
 +> Cannot find module
 +
 +=== Фикс ===
 +
 +<code>
 +apt-get install snmp-mibs-cisco snmp-mibs-doc-mibrfcs snmp-mibs-ext snmp-mibs-raritan snmp-mibs-std
 +</code>
 +
 +
 +==== Не видит своего агента ====
 +
 +=== Фикс ===
 +
 +В настройке сервера: ''/etc/glaber/glaber_server.conf'' \\ 
 +Установить значение: ''StartGlbAgentPollers=0'' \\ 
 +
 +
 +==== Не видит fping ====
 +
 +> At least one of '/usr/sbin/fping', '/usr/sbin/fping6' must exist. Both are missing in the system.
 +
 +> /usr/sbin/fping: can't create socket (must run as root?)
 +
 +=== Фикс ===
 +
 +Даем права на fping
 +
 +<code>
 +chown root:glaber /usr/sbin/fping
 +chmod 710 /usr/sbin/fping
 +chmod ug+s /usr/sbin/fping
 +</code>
 +
 +
 +===== Источники =====
  
 +  * [[https://docs.glaber.ru/]]
 +  * [[https://www.altlinux.org/Установка_и_первоначальная_настройка_ZABBIX]]
  
  
flip/glaber/installing_glaber_3.5_on_alt_linux_10.4.1756904876.txt.gz · Последнее изменение: 2025/09/03 13:07 — flip

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ki